Vincent Wilson, 68, of Waterbury, CT, passed away peacefully on September 4, 2025. He was born on April 28, 1957, in Manhattan, NY, to the late Francis and Woodrow Wilson.
After graduating from high school in New York City, Vincent proudly served his country in the United States Navy. He went on to dedicate many years of service at Stony Brook University, Waste Management, and working with individuals with disabilities.

Affectionately known as “Uncle V” in Bellport, NY, Vincent was well loved for his passion for fixing bikes and helping others. He enjoyed caring for dogs, watching wrestling with his family, and most of all, spending time surrounded by his loved ones.
